A Main regional Civil Engineering Contractor is seeking a Project/Senior Planner to work within their Civil Engineering function within the London & SE area, mainly the Kent region
The ideal candidate must have a strong civils background with good experience in highways (new build and reconstruction, infrastructure and structures).
The ideal candidate must have:
• Working knowledge of NEC, ECC/ICE Forms of Contract, SHW, SHW method of measurements and CESMM, Team Plan, HND/Degree in Civil Engineering or relevant experience gained from carrying out a similar role
• Strong civils background with good experience in major highways (new build and reconstruction
• Proficient in Asta Planning Software
Duties & Responsibilities:
• Production of tender and contract programme
• Production of planning file, notes and worksheets
• Production of quality phasing drawings/flowcharts/time slices/mass-haul diagrams
• Identifies temporary works and traffic management requirements
• Putting forward VE alternatives
• Produces programmes showing key constraints/key off-site procurement and design/key resources levelled and linked/float analysis/time risk allowances and is of optimistic and realistic overall durations
• Liaises with internal and external colleagues
• Production of change programme and revised contract
• Management of as built records and measure productivity
• Production of planning report
• Measurement of planning standard
• Identifies opportunities and threats
